
Since my first post a couple of weeks ago, I've added some neat features to my mod which adds an analog clock and pendulum to Minecraft.
The clock can now be customized with dyes and metals – the face can be tinted any color and the clock hands can be plated with gold or iron nuggets (also copper nuggets in 1.21.9+). You can use a brush to remove the dye and a pickaxe to remove the metal plating.
The pendulum now chimes 4 times throughout the day (sunrise, noon, sunset, and midnight) with each playing a different chime jingle. This requires the pendulum to be placed in front of a bell, but the chiming will not alert villagers or raids 🙂
